7 Things to Do Near Gardaland & Lake Garda

Gardaland is surrounded by some of the most scenic and culturally rich areas in northern Italy, making it easy to extend your visit beyond the park itself.
1. Explore Lake Garda Towns
Charming towns like Peschiera del Garda and Lazise offer a relaxed lakeside atmosphere with historic streets, small shops, and waterfront restaurants. After a full day at Gardaland, these towns are ideal for slowing down, enjoying a walk along the promenade, or sitting down for a meal with views over Lake Garda.
2. Take a Boat Tour on Lake Garda
A boat tour is one of the best ways to experience Lake Garda from a different perspective. As you move across the water, you’ll pass elegant villas, small harbor towns, and mountain backdrops. Options range from short scenic cruises to longer routes that connect several towns along the lake.
3. Visit Parco Natura Viva
Located just a short drive from Gardaland, this wildlife park offers a combination of a drive through safari and a walking zoo. Visitors can see animals in large, natural style habitats while learning about conservation efforts. It is especially popular with families and provides a completely different experience from a traditional theme park.
4. Discover Parco Giardino Sigurtà
Often considered one of the most beautiful garden parks in Italy, this large green space is known for its landscaped gardens, seasonal flower displays, and peaceful walking paths. It is ideal for those looking to slow down and enjoy nature, offering a calm and scenic alternative to the busy atmosphere of Gardaland.
5. Enjoy Parco Cavour
Parco Cavour is a spacious water park set within a natural park environment, featuring pools, slides, and sandy beach style areas. Compared to more intense water parks, it offers a more relaxed experience, making it a good option for families or visitors looking to unwind during the summer months.
6. Relax at Parco Termale del Garda
This thermal park offers a completely different atmosphere, with natural hot spring lakes, spa facilities, and landscaped gardens. It is ideal for relaxation after a busy day at Gardaland, providing a quieter and more restorative experience focused on wellness and comfort.
7. Discover Verona
Located about 30 minutes away, Verona offers a completely different experience with its historic center, Roman Arena, and lively piazzas. It is one of the most popular day trips from Gardaland and works well as either a half day visit or a full day exploring its cultural landmarks.

Gardaland is located in Castelnuovo del Garda, near Lake Garda in northern Italy. It is easily accessible from Verona and nearby towns, making it a popular day trip destination in the region.
Gardaland is widely considered one of the best theme parks in Italy, offering a mix of thrill rides, family attractions, and themed experiences. For many visitors, it is a highlight of a trip to Lake Garda, especially when planned in advance.
One full day is usually enough to experience the main rides and attractions. However, during peak periods, it may require prioritizing certain areas, especially if you want to include additional experiences like the aquarium or water park.
Gardaland can be reached by train, car, or bus. The nearest train station is Peschiera del Garda, with shuttle connections to the park. It is also easily accessible by road from nearby cities like Verona.
Gardaland is not open daily year round. The main season runs from spring to early fall, while winter openings are limited to special events like Magic Winter. Opening days and hours vary, so checking the schedule in advance is recommended.
